    The Wolf pistols have a fairly unusual fixed barrel design with partial/internal slide, and a correspondingly odd look. I think the idea was that the fixed barrel would increase accuracy, and with less slide mass going back and forth, the recoil would be gentler (ie less slide "smack").

    The guns were big, heavy, expensive to manufacture, and of questionable reliability and durability. Ultimately the Austrian company that made them went belly up.

    In typical fashion, CDNN then bought up all the remainder for pennies on the dollar and sold them out at fire-sale prices as "collectible only" advising not to shoot them (that's not a good sign!). Some of these were fairly tricked out too, with compensators, adjustable match sights, etc.
